No one won the jackpot in Saturday night’s Powerball drawing.
The jackpot has now grown to $1.3 billion — the largest Powerball jackpot in history,
There were two $50,000 wining tickets sold in our area, and a $1 million ticket was sold in Hampton Roads.
The winners in our area include tickets sold in Montclair and Manassas. The winners of the tickets have not been identified.
